Should my indoor cats get flea/worm meds when a new puppy arrives?

Updated on September 23rd, 2025

I currently have two older cats and am going to get a puppy next month. I live on the 4th floor apartment and dont need to give my cats flea or worm medicine because they are inside all day. When I get a puppy I plan on putting it on flea and worm medicine, should I also do this for my cats? Thanks.

Unfortunately your puppy can bring in a live flea and that flea can then hop on your cat(s). So it is a good idea to also put flea prevention on your kitties. Make sure it is labelled as suitable for cats.
